To My Loving Wife
when i fail
i must tell you
i do not hide
my weaknesses
i reveal to you
the inner wars
that i have lost
many times,
i do not pretend
that my love
shall triumph in
everything in every-way
there are lapses
shortcomings that
at first i could
have kept within me
we love each other
and in my strengths
you shall love me
more perhaps but in
those situations that
i utterly fail,
i must admit to you
with all courage
that i am down, and
yet you still love me
kiss me, and hug me
like a child that has
come back to you
after having been
lost in the park
i am weaker now
so tired and about
to lose hope of the
promises that i can
be....come with me
sleep with me and
make me feel that
i am the hawk surfing
the skies for its
night stars
once again.
poem
by
Ric S. Bastasa
